Medihealer’s 2-pack chin straps are designed to reduce snoring by keeping your mouth closed during sleep. Made from soft, breathable materials, these adjustable straps fit all head sizes comfortably and help prevent dry mouth and sore throat by minimizing air loss. Reusable and machine washable, they offer an affordable, effective solution for mouth breathers seeking instant snoring relief.

A quick tip that may help…
My husband uses these to make his CPAP effective. He has used the name brand ones because that’s what the company sent and they are covered by insurance, but only at rather long intervals. My husband’s disease is dementia, so they are often misplaced or even fall apart before we are eligible for a new one since he can be rough on things, lacking the comprehension to be careful. The CPAP doesn’t work without the strap so it is critical we always have an extra on hand. That brought me here and I decided to go with this choice since it is basically just for backup.Overall I think these are at least as good as the name brand, but there are two flaws I note…1. Directions are not clear and are unnecessarily complicated. The chin pocket has a smooth side and a velvet side. My intuition was to put the velvet side out, just as you would wear it with clothing. When it didn’t work well I looked at the pictures and realized it should be worn velvet side next to the skin. The directions don’t explicitly state this but the photos are clear and when worn this way, the complications with the strap go away. Velvet side next to the skin also puts seams away from skin so it becomes a very gentle chin pocket when worn properly. The product is fine put the directions need improvement.2. The other flaw is with the slit in the strap. It only works if your head is exactly the right size. My husband’s head is large. This strap fits fine but when secured, the slit is off center, so can’t be split as shown in illustrations. It still works for him when used as a single strap but it can’t be spread for additional stability. I looked at whether I could lengthen the slit but, while I could cut it with a pair of scissors, the lengthened slit would not be long enough to fix things.I see some people don’t like the long strap when used on a smaller head. That really is a problem that can be solved with scissors. Once you have your fit you can cut it to size.Overall, this is a good value. For us it is certainly good enough for backup. We will continue to use this one as a primary for at least a while.
